Tourism airplane intercepted over the Tyrrhenian Sea

Trapani, Italy - An Italian Air Force's F-16 took immediately off yesterday to detect the plane which had abnormally kept the radio silence

A South African tourism single engine four seats airplane flying over the Tyrrhenian Sea yesterday alarmed Italy due to its radio silence and this fact warned Italian Air Force.
